病毒样颗粒的常用表达系统和应用进展

             

摘要

病毒样颗粒是由病毒的结构蛋白组成,不含感染所必需的核酸成分,没有感染性和复制能力,但是可以同时引起细胞免疫和体液免疫.由于具有与亲本病毒相似的形态和结构的特点,病毒样颗粒受到研究者的极大关注.与其他病毒亚单位疫苗相比,病毒样颗粒具有安全高效的特点.本综述论述了病毒样颗粒的常用表达系统以及在生物制品方面的应用.%Virus-like particles (VLPs) formed by the structural proteins of viruses are essentially devoid of infectious genetic materials.Therefore,VLPS are non-infective and non-replicable but can still stimulate strong humoral and cellular immune responses.In the recent years,VLPs have received considerable attention due to their structures and morphology similar to native viruses.VLPs are safer and more effective than many other kinds of subunit vaccines against animal viral diseases.This paper reviews the expression systems and applications of VLPs in biological products.
